The NIV Committee on Bible Translation

In January 2002 the NIV Committee on Bible Translation was composed of:

1.  John Stek, Chairman of the Committee on Bible Translation
Calvin Theological Seminary, Part-time Professor of Old Testament
Denominational Affiliation: Christian Reformed Church

2.  Donald H. Madvig, Vice-Chairman of the Committee on Bible Translation
Retired Pastor and Professor of Biblical Studies
Denominational Affiliation: Evangelical Covenant

3.  Kenneth L. Barker, Secretary of the Committee on Bible Translation
Dallas Theological Seminary, Adjunct Professor of Hebrew and Old Testament Studies
Denominational Affiliation: Southern Baptist

4.  Gordon Fee
Regent College, Professor of New Testament Studies
Denominational Affiliation: Assemblies of God

5.  Richard T. France
Parrish Minister, England and Wales
Denominational Affiliation: Church of England

NIV Translators and Editors,
and their Institutional and Church Affiliations

The following list of NIV translators and editors is reproduced from the list provided by the International Bible Society in September 1993. The list does not always give the church affiliation of the persons listed. In a few cases there is no institutional affiliation given, but only a city of residence. Presumably, the names listed are all those who participated in the translation of the original NIV (1973-1978) or of the revision of 1984. Many of the people listed here are known to have had only a very minor role in the translation.

1 John H. Stek is currently (2001) the Chairman of the NIV's Committee on Bible Translation.

2 Ronald Youngblood is currently (2001) the Chairman of the Board of Directors of the International Bible Society, which owns the NIV copright and is the employer of the Committee on Bible Translation. He was the executive editor of the New International Reader's Version (NIrV), a simplified and gender-neutral revision of the NIV marketed for children, and is currently a member of the CBT.
